Designer Notes: Practical Checks Before Deployment
Before integrating Watercolor Hearts Cutting Board Design into a campaign, test it thoroughly:
- Test with your brand color palette to ensure harmony
- Check black and white usage for print or grayscale applications
- Place it in real campaign mockups to see how it performs
- Preview on mobile screens for visual clarity
- Test readability in small sizes if used with text overlays
- Compare against competitor visuals to ensure differentiation
- Pair with different fonts—serif, sans serif, script, and display—to check versatility
- Review spacing and balance in both centered and full-bleed layouts
- Confirm commercial licensing before using in client work or paid campaigns
